Key Insights of Japan Endothelin 1 Market
- Market size estimated at approximately $250 million in 2024, with significant growth potential driven by unmet clinical needs.
- Projected CAGR of 8.5% from 2026 to 2033, fueled by increasing adoption of ET-1 antagonists in cardiovascular therapy.
- Dominant segment: Prescription drugs targeting pulmonary hypertension, accounting for over 60% of revenue share.
- Primary application focus: Management of pulmonary arterial hypertension (PAH) and systemic hypertension.
- Leading geographic influence: Japan’s advanced healthcare infrastructure and high disease prevalence sustain its market dominance.
- Major companies: Actelion (Johnson & Johnson), Bayer, and local biotech startups investing heavily in innovative ET-1 modulators.
- Market opportunity: Growing aging population and rising awareness of ET-1’s role in vascular health present significant expansion avenues.
- Regulatory landscape: Streamlined approval processes for novel therapies and increasing government funding bolster market entry prospects.

Japan Endothelin 1 Market Regulatory Environment and Policy Impact
Japan’s regulatory framework for biopharmaceuticals is characterized by a rigorous yet supportive environment for innovative therapies. The Pharmaceuticals and Medical Devices Agency (PMDA) facilitates accelerated approval pathways for breakthrough drugs, especially those addressing unmet needs. Recent policy initiatives aim to promote personalized medicine, digital health integration, and clinical research collaborations.
Reimbursement policies are evolving to accommodate high-cost therapies, with health technology assessment (HTA) playing a pivotal role. The government’s emphasis on aging populations and chronic disease management incentivizes market players to develop targeted ET-1 therapies. Regulatory stability, combined with proactive policy support, enhances Japan’s attractiveness as a launchpad for novel treatments.
